You don't get to choose the year you contend. Yes, our young guys might be better next year. But consider what has happened THIS year:

Burrow came back better than anyone could have hoped
Chase blew up
We hit on every free agent signing except Waynes
We signed Apple off the street to replace Waynes
We have been remarkably lucky with injuries and (so far, knock on wood) Covid
The rest of the division has crapped the bed

All signs say that THIS IS OUR YEAR. So hell yes, this is a Super Bowl team.
